A new search engine marketing services company, Dentsu Search & Link has been formed in Japan by New York-based 24/7 Real Media Inc. and Cyber Communications Inc. (CCI) of Toyko.
The venture, which combines subsidiaries of each company, is intended to leverage CCI’s client relationships in Japan, with licensed search management technology from 24/7.
The deal merges Dentsu E-Link Inc. and K.K. 24-7 Search. Japan’s largest advertising agency Dentsu Inc., which owns shares in both companies, will remain a shareholder in the new entity. Financial terms have not been disclosed.
The new firm will provide services for CCI’s and Dentsu’s agency clients, while expanding 24/7 Real Media’s technology presence in Japan.
Takeshi Matsuoka, director and president of KK 24-7 Search will serve as president and CEO for Dentsu Search & Link.
